The basics of trail running shoes
Why trail running shoes are must-haves for off-road runners
Every runner knows the thrill of tackling the wild, and that’s where trail running shoes step in. These shoes aren’t just your standard running gear. With their unique design, they offer superior traction on uneven surfaces – think sticky rubber outsoles and deep lugs that grip the terrain.
They also boast firmer midsoles for ample support and robust rock plates that act as your own personal bodyguard against sharp objects. So, no matter if it’s a pebbly path or a muddy incline, trail running shoes ensure your feet stay secure and comfortable.
Trail running shoes vs. standard running shoes: spotting the differences
Running might be a universal sport, but your shoes should match the terrain.
While road running shoes are designed for flat surfaces – featuring smooth rubber outsoles and softer midsoles for better shock absorption – trail running shoes are made for the wild.
In comparison, road running shoes feature lightweight, highly breathable uppers that, although comfortable, might not fare well against harsh trail conditions. Trail running shoes? They’re the sturdy, reliable companions you need when it’s just you and the great outdoors.
Versatility of trail running shoes
Are trail running shoes good for hiking?
Well, they very well can, depending on the turf you plan to tread.
If you’re aiming for speed and agility over relatively simple terrain, trail running shoes might just be your perfect companion when hiking. But for shorter distances or on more challenging terrain, a hiking shoe could give you that much-needed extra cushioning and toughness.
Can you wear trail running shoes on the road?
Yes, your trusty trail running shoes can venture onto the roads. However, trail runners carry a bit more weight than their road-specific counterparts.
This could lead to some discomfort when running longer distances on hard surfaces. Still, if you’re a running enthusiast seeking the thrill of both terrains, trail runners won’t disappoint. Just brace yourself for a tad bit more exertion when you’re clocking those extra miles on the asphalt.

How long should trail running shoes last?
What influences the lifespan of your trail running shoes?
The lifespan of your trail running shoes depends on numerous variables.
Dedicated use typically ensures a longer lifespan. A lot also depends on the quality of the shoes you invest in. A good quality pair should serve you well for around 500 to 800 kilometres. Bear in mind that this is just a guideline; the specific terrain you tread upon can cause variations.
When should you consider replacing your trail running shoes?
Wondering when it’s time to bid farewell to your trusty running companions? Just take a gander at their soles. Signs of worn-out tread are key indicators that your shoes might be nearing the end of their journey.
Much like car tyres, when the tread begins to wear thin, your traction on loose surfaces may be compromised, raising your risk of slipping. Running with worn or damaged shoes can be a shortcut to injury. So, stay mindful of the condition of your shoes – it’s a crucial aspect of your trail running experience.

What is the right way to maintain trail running shoes for a longer lifespan?
Extend the life of your trail shoes by first removing the insole before cleaning. Use a brush and warm water for surface dirt.
Rinse inside, avoiding detergents to protect adhesives. For a thorough clean, use a damp cloth and toothbrush. Ensure they dry fully at room temperature, and stuff some rolled paper towels to help.

Do I need to break in trail running shoes?
Breaking in trail shoes can help you feel more comfortable when it’s time to hit the terrain. We recommend short runs or walks before hitting the trails, helping your shoes mould to your feet and avoiding early blisters.
